The Importance of Play-Based Learning in Preschool

Table of Contents

 

 

Play-Based Learning

Play-Based Learning is a great way for preschoolers to learn important skills while having fun. Young learners naturally explore, interact, and solve problems through play-based learning, which makes them more curious and confident.

Adding Play-Based Learning to early education makes a safe space where kids may learn and grow socially, emotionally, and intellectually while having fun.

Key Benefits of Play-Based Learning

Play-Based Learning helps kids learn in a fun and natural method that helps them grow in all areas of their lives: mentally, socially, emotionally, and physically. Kids learn how to think critically, solve problems, and talk to other people while they play.

Cognitive Development

Children do things that help their brains grow as they learn through play. Building blocks, puzzles, and memory games can all help you think logically and solve problems. Kids learn how to spot patterns, put things in order, and create connections, all of which are important for doing well in school in the future.

Social Skills and Teamwork

During play, preschoolers often talk to other kids. Children learn how to share, negotiate, and settle disagreements through activities like role-playing, group games, and working together on projects. Play-Based Learning helps kids learn how to work together, feel for others, and understand them, all of which are important for Successful Social Interactions.

Emotional Growth

Children’s emotional development is fostered through play, providing a space for the open expression and management of feelings. Through activities such as imaginative play and storytelling, children can cultivate emotional awareness, develop empathy, and enhance their self-assurance. Therefore, play-based learning contributes to the development of resilience and emotional intelligence in children, both of which are essential for navigating life’s challenges.

Language and Communication Skills

Language and communication skills are cultivated through play, as children engage with stories, conversations, and new words. This environment supports vocabulary growth, improved understanding, and the honing of expressive abilities. Also, play-based learning promotes social interaction, prompting children to express their viewpoints, ask questions, and recount their experiences.

Physical Development

Many games require physical activity, coordination, and the use of your motor skills. Dancing, outdoor play, and simple exercises are all excellent ways to build muscle, improve balance, and refine hand-eye coordination. Play-Based Learning, which incorporates Physical Movement into everyday activities, is beneficial for both health and development.

Creativity and Imagination

Playing pretend helps kids think outside the box and come up with new ideas. Kids can learn new things by drawing, creating, and playing pretend. Play-Based Learning encourages curiosity and creativity, which are both important for learning throughout life.

How to Incorporate Play-Based Learning in Preschool?

  • Structured Play Areas: Create areas with blocks, art tools, and puzzles where kids can play alone or with others.
  • Activities with a theme: Use themes like “space adventure” or “market day” to make role-playing games that teach real-life skills.
  • Hands-On Projects: Get kids to do science experiments, cook, or simple building chores to make learning interesting.
  • Exploring Outside: Nature walks, gardening, and playing on the playground are all fun ways to learn about the environment and get some exercise.
  • Interactive Storytelling: Use stories and puppets to help kids use their imaginations, learn new words, and understand what they read.
